Having spent some time following the media coverage and personal narratives around Meghan Markle, I've come to realize how her story reflects broader issues about fame, privacy, and the expectations placed on public figures. Like many, I initially admired the idea of an American joining the British royal family—a modern, relatable figure who could bring freshness and openness. However, as more details emerged through interviews, podcasts, and public statements, my perspective shifted. It's easy to forget that every family faces struggles, and the royal family is no exception. But the way these issues have been aired publicly—through Oprah interviews, tell-all books, and frequent media appearances—turns private conflicts into a spectacle. This constant exposure can sometimes feel less like an attempt to foster understanding and more like a platform for grievances. I’ve observed that this has sparked mixed reactions worldwide, with some seeing it as courageous honesty and others perceiving it as oversharing or attention-seeking. From a personal viewpoint, authenticity matters deeply. When someone claims to be authentic but seems to court the spotlight relentlessly, it can come across as contradictory. Watching Meghan promote values like compassion and work-life balance while simultaneously engaging heavily on media platforms creates a complex image. Moreover, there's the issue of privacy — a concept highly valued yet challenging to uphold when your life is constantly scrutinized. Meghan and Harry’s experiences highlight the difficulty of balancing personal boundaries with public interest. Their story has opened up conversations about race, mental health, and the pressures of royal life, which I appreciate. Still, the ongoing public discourse sometimes feels exhausting due to its intensity and the emotional weight it carries. As a follower of this saga, I've learned to approach it with nuance. Instead of absolute admiration or disdain, acknowledging the multifaceted nature of people's actions and motivations helps. It's a reminder that public figures like Meghan Markle are complex individuals navigating an extraordinary situation under relentless public gaze. This reflection has helped me understand the conflicted sentiments that many, including myself, experience regarding her.
